What Documents Do Estonian citizens Need to Submit an Application for an Egypt e-Visa?
Estonian citizens must fulfil Egypt's minimum visa requirements. These consist of things like submitting a number of things:
- On the day of their arrival date, Estonian citizens must have a passport that is active for a minimum of six months after their arrival.
- Email address that gets used regularly
- Credit or debit card
- Egypt lodging information
- Image of the passport's personal section in electronic form
- Estonian citizens whose passports lapse in a span of six months need to reissue them before applying for an Egyptian e-Visa.
The Egypt eVisa is connected to the authorized Passport. If you reissue or change your Estonian passport shortly after requesting for an Egyptian e-Visa, it will cease to be authorized. You must reapply with your new Passport.

How long can Estonian citizens stay in Egypt using e-Visa?
The Egyptian e-Visa for Estonian citizens is available as either a Single-Entry or Multiple-Entry permit. The Single-Entry visa is effective for a period of ninety days from the day it is issued and allows one entry into Egypt for a maximum stay of 30 days. The Multiple-Entry visa permits multiple entries within a 180-day period, with each stay not exceeding 30 days. Both types e-Visa are connected to the applicant's Passport. As a result, visitors have to get into Egypt using the identical passport they provided on the e-Visa application form.
Can Estonian citizens receive a visa to Egypt upon arrival?
Yes, Estonian citizens with passports who have recently arrived in Egypt are eligible for a visa on entry. However, this method permits for one entry into the nation and frequently requires waiting in queue at border check. There is additionally the possibility that in the event your visa-on-arrival request is denied for any cause, you will be unable to get into Egypt and will be forced to book a trip back to Estonia.
The Egyptian e-Visa for Estonian citizens is a considerably faster and more comfortable option and it gives you peace that you have an authorised visa before you leave.
